无法从NSTableView中拖出多行

时间:2019-12-12 15:55:14

标签: objective-c macos cocoa drag-and-drop nstableview

我正在编写一个应用程序,该应用程序应允许我将项目从NSTableView拖动到另一个视图(自定义时间轴视图)。 只要我的NSTableView中只有一项,它就可以完美地工作。拳头图像显示从表格视图中拖动了一项。

enter image description here

但是,一旦我的表格视图中有多个项目,我将无法再从中拖动它。它只是选择该行。第二张图片显示了我试图从表格视图中拖动多个项目。 enter image description here

我需要做些什么来启用从表格视图中拖动吗?

1 个答案:

答案 0 :(得分:0)

已解决。 在我的pasteboardWriterForRow委托调用中,我返回nil而不是有效对象。